About This School
Leston College is a private for-profit institution located in Bayamon, PR with approximately 49 undergraduate students enrolled. The average net price after financial aid is $6,188 per year. The graduation rate is 20%, and the typical graduate earns $20,700 within 10 years of enrollment.
This school would need to show a very compelling case to recommend it to almost any student, and honestly, the data doesn't make that case. With a graduation rate of just 20%, the odds are stacked against students finishing — meaning most who enroll leave without a degree and still carry debt. The median earnings of $20,700 ten years after enrollment are below what many students could earn after a short-term workforce certification, which raises real questions about return on investment even when the net price of $6,188 per year seems affordable on the surface. The extremely small enrollment of 49 undergraduates could mean limited course offerings, few extracurriculars, and a fragile institutional structure. My honest advice: before applying here, seriously explore UPR campuses, Inter American University of Puerto Rico, or other accredited nonprofit options in the region that offer stronger graduation outcomes and better long-term earnings potential for your investment.
